Applications: Use as a positive control for transductionOptimize transduction assays and track protein expression over time

Description: Adeno-Associated Virus-DJ (AAV-DJ) is a synthetic serotype made from eight different wild-type AAV serotypes (AAV2, 4, 5, 8, 9, avian, bovine, and goat AAV) using DNA shuffling.  These modifications give the AAV-DJ serotype improved transduction efficiency in vitro and in vivo compared to wild-type serotypes. Consequently, AAV-DJ can infect a broad range of cell types.These AAV-DJ particles constitutively express the firefly (Photinus pyralis) luciferase under the control of a CMV promoter.

Formulation: AAV-DJ was produced in HEK293-AAV cells and is supplied in PBS-MK (PBS Magnesium-Potassium) buffer containing 0.01% Pluronic F68.

Purification: The purity of the AAV particles was confirmed to be greater than 90% by staining with One-Step Lumitein™ UV Protein Gel Stain (Biotium #21005-1L). The purity will vary with each lot; the exact value is provided with each shipment.

Storage Stability: AAV is shipped with dry ice. For long-term storage, it is recommended to store AAV at -80°C. Av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les. Titers can drop significantly with each freeze-thaw cycle.

Supplied As: Two vials (50 µl x 2) of AAV at a titer ≥1 x 1012 TU/ml. The titer is determined by qPCR and will vary with each lot; the exact value is provided with each shipment.

Warnings: Avoid freeze/thaw cycles

Biosafety Level: BSL-1
